San Sebastián, Spain — Multiverse Computing, a European AI unicorn, has unveiled two groundbreaking ultra-small AI models: SuperFly ("Fly Brain") and ChickBrain ("Chicken Brain"). These models leverage quantum physics-inspired compression to deliver high-performance AI for edge devices.

The Technology Behind the Models

The company's proprietary CompactifAI compression algorithm reduces model sizes without sacrificing performance. Co-founder Román Orús explained: "Our quantum physics-based approach enables finer compression than traditional methods."

  • SuperFly: Compressed from 135M to 94M parameters (comparable to a fly's brain), it runs on minimal hardware like Arduino processors.
  • ChickBrain: A 3.2B-parameter model compressed from Meta's Llama3.18B, capable of offline reasoning on a MacBook.

Performance and Applications

In benchmark tests (MMLU-Pro, Math500, GSM8K, GPQA Diamond), ChickBrain outperformed its original larger model. SuperFly enables voice-controlled IoT devices (e.g., washing machines) without cloud dependency.

Key Partnerships

Multiverse is negotiating with Apple, Samsung, Sony, and HP (an existing investor). Its AWS-hosted API offers cost-efficient model compression services to developers.

Industry Impact

This launch signals a shift from cloud-based AI to edge-device intelligence, offering faster responses and enhanced privacy.
